Your Computer HomeScreen 

Here, you will find out what the icons on your computer's desktop are and what each of them do. With some applications, there are tutorials that will teach you how to use them.​

Picture

Applications

Picture
TeamViewer
TeamViewer is an application where you can remotely control your computer and perform desktop sharing, online meetings, web conferencing, and file transfer between computers. Here's a link to a tutorial for it (https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=vghy4zXfITg).
Picture
Tux Paint
It's an application that allows you to draw on your computer. Think of it as a notebook or a sketch pad on your computer. Here's a link to your site for more information (http://www.tuxpaint.org/).​ ​​
Picture
SUPER AntiSpyware Free Edition
This is an application that protects your computer from malware, spyware, trojans, and more (all things you don't want on your computer) Here is a link to their website (https://www.superantispyware.com/free-edition.html) and a link to a tutorial about this application and how to use it (​https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=d2e4cSv_U6I).
Picture
Google
This is a commonly used search engine that allows you to search for websites across the internet. ​
Picture
RapidTyping
An easy-to-use typing trainer that helps you improve your typing speed and accuracy.
Picture
Microsoft Office
Includes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int. Create documents, spreadsheets and presentations.

AT&T Low Cost Internet
$5-$20/month Internet throughout Monterey County. Find more information at https://m.att.com/shopmobile/internet/access/.
Picture
Spectrum Low-income Internet
$15-$20/month high speed internet in Prunedale, Castroville, Chular, Gonzales, Soledad, Greenfield and King City. Find more information at https://www.spectrum.com/browse/content/spectrum-internet-assist.
Picture
Comcast Low cost Internet
$10/month high speed internet in Salinas, Seaside, Monterey, Pacific Grove and Marina. Find more information at https://www.internetessentials.com/.
Picture
Xfinity Low Cost Internet
25/3 Mbps Internet service for just $9.95 a month plus tax. Find more information at https://www.xfinity.com/support/articles/comcast-broadband-opportunity-program.
